"Chi kung, meaning 'energy cultivation', is one of the original components of Traditional Chinese Medicine and is at the heart of T'ai Chi. It is an art which combines aerobic conditioning with meditation and relaxation, making it an ideal practice for people of every age and all levels of fitness. A few minutes' practice each day will help you to reclaim the vitality that is naturally yours. Beginning with a basic history of Traditional Chinese Medicine, the book includes a variety of everyday exercise routines as well as sequences which focus on sexual health, women, the ageing process and the workplace. Also included are exercise routines designed to help the body combat a number of common ailments.

"Salah satu gejala paling umum dan menyedihkan yang dilaporkan pasien kanker selama kemoterapi adalah fatigue. Fatigue yang dialami pasien berdampak besar terhadap aktifitas sehari-hari. Taichi merupakan salah satu intervensi mind-body yang terbukti meningkatkan kesehatan mental dan kondisi psikologis.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k menilai efektifitas latihan tai-chi dalam menurunkan fatigue pada pasien kanker payudara yang sedang menjalankan kemoterapi. Desain penelitian Randomized Clinical Trial (RCT) dengan 50 sampel secara consecutive sampling, 25 kelompok intervensi dan 25 kelompok kontrol. Hasil penelitian latihan taichi efektif menurunkan skor fatigue pada pasien kanker payudara yang menjalankan kemoterapi dibandingkan kelompok kontrol yang mendapatkan standard care di rumah sakit (p= 0,01). Rekomendasi penelitian latihan taichi diberikan pada pasien kanker payudara untuk mengatasi fatigue dalam menjalankan kemotarapi.

Fatigue is one of the most common and distressing symptoms reported by cancer patients during chemotherapy. Patient fatigue has a significant impact on daily activities. Tai-chi is a mind-body intervention that improves mental health and psychological state. This research aims to evaluate the effectiveness of Tai-chi exercise in reducing fatigue in breast cancer patients undergoing chemotherapy. Research design Randomized Clinical Trial (RCT) with 50 samples by consecutive sampling, 25 intervention groups, and 25 control groups. The results of the Tai-chi exercise effectively reduced fatigue scores in breast cancer patients undergoing chemotherapy compared to the control group who received standard care at the hospital (p = 0.01). Research recommendations Tai-chi exercise is given to breast cancer patients to overcome fatigue in running chemotherapy."

"Masalah psikologis yang terbanyak dirasakan oleh perawat saat pandemi Covid-19 adalah ansietas. Ansietas yang dialami oleh perawat dampak dari pandemi Covid-19 yaitu ansietas ringan, ansietas sedang, dan ansietas berat.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k mengetahui pengaruh pemberian terapi tarik napas dalam, hipnosis lima jari dan Progressive Muscle Relaxation (PMR) terhadap penurunan kecemasan perawat pada masa pandemi Covid-19 di RSUD Leuwiliang Kabupaten Bogor. Desain penelitian ini menggunakan quasi eksperimental pre test-post test with control group. Sampel penelitian 64 responden perawat, 32 orang responden sebagai kelompok intervensi yang mendapatkan terapi tarik napas dalam, hipnosis lima jari, dan Progressive Muscle Relaxation (PMR) dan 32 orang responden kelompok kontrol yang mendapatkan terapi tarik napas dalam dan hipnosis lima jari. Kriteria inklusi yaitu perawat pelaksana, bersedia menjadi responden dan menandatangani surat persetujuan, tidak sedang cutiatau libur, skor ansietas ≥ 14. Alat ukur yang digunakan kuisioner HRS-A. Analisis data menggunakan uji T. Hasil penelitian ditemukan adanya penurunan kecemasan perawat yang mendapatkan terapi tarik napas dalam, hipnosis lima jari, dan Progressive Muscle Relaxation (PMR) lebih besar dibandingkan dengan kelompok yang mendapatkan terapi tarik napas dalam dan hipnosis lima jari (p value < 0,05). Terapi tarik napas dalam, hipnosis lima jari, dan Progressive Muscle Relaxation (PMR) direkomendasikan untuk terapi keperawatan dalam mengatasi ansietas baik pada pasien atau perawat, dan dapat dijadikan sebagai evidence based dalam membandingkan keefektifan sebagai terapi yang dapat diberikan pada klien ansietas

The most psychological problem felt by nurses during the Covid-19 pandemic was anxiety. The anxiety experienced by nurses as a result of the Covid-19 pandemic is mild anxiety, moderate anxiety, and severe anxiety. This study aims to determine the effect of giving deep breathing therapy, five finger hypnosis and Progressive Muscle Relaxation (PMR) on reducing nurse anxiety during the Covid-19 pandemic at Leuwiliang Hospital, Bogor Regency. The design of this study used a quasi-experimental pre-test-post-test with control group. The research sample was 64 nurse respondents, 32 respondents as an intervention group who received deep breathing therapy, five finger hypnosis, and Progressive Muscle Relaxation (PMR) and 32 control group respondents who received deep breathing therapy and five finger hypnosis. The inclusion criteria were implementing nurses, willing to be respondents and signing a letter of agreement, not on leave or vacation, anxiety score 14. The measuring instrument used was the HRS-A questionnaire. Data analysis using T test. The results of the study found that the decrease in anxiety of nurses who received deep breathing therapy, five-finger hypnosis, and Progressive Muscle Relaxation (PMR) was greater than the group who received deep-breathing therapy and five-finger hypnosis (p value <0.05). Deep breathing therapy, five finger hypnosis, and Progressive Muscle Relaxation (PMR) are recommended for nursing therapy in overcoming anxiety in both patients and nurses, and can be used as evidence based in comparing the effectiveness of therapy that can be given to anxiety clients.
